Buying or selling property in Queensland can be stressful, but it doesn’t have to be. Follow these essential tips for a smooth conveyancing process from offer to settlement:
1. Understand the Contract – Review all clauses and special conditions with a lawyer.
2. Complete Disclosures Accurately – Sellers must provide a full Seller Disclosure Statement.
3. Do Property Searches Early – Check for easements, covenants, and zoning issues.
4. Prepare for Settlement – Have finances, deposits, and inspections ready.
5. Communicate Clearly – Keep buyers, sellers, agents, and lawyers in the loop.
6. Don’t Delay Legal Checks – Engage a lawyer early to identify and fix issues.
7. Trust a Conveyancing Lawyer – Professional legal advice ensures compliance and protects your property.
